Today, President El-Sisi participated via video conference in the high-level meeting in preparation for the Fourth International Conference on Financing for Development, scheduled to be held in Spain at the end of June 2025.

The Spokesman for the Presidency, Ambassador Mohamed El-Shennawy, said the high-level meeting aims to give political momentum for the Fourth International Conference on Financing for Development, a major international event aimed at mobilizing funding and encouraging investment in projects that contribute to achieving the Sustainable Development Goals, enhancing international cooperation in the field of financing for development, and bridging the growing development gap.

President El-Sisi delivered a speech, during which he reviewed the pillars of Egypt’s vision for enhancing international efforts to finance development.

The Fourth International Conference on Financing for Development is held at a critical international moment, amid mounting international challenges, particularly the escalation of geopolitical and security tensions, the increase in unilateral and protectionist measures, the decline in efforts to achieve the Sustainable Development Goals, also the widening related financing gap related to them, and the growing repercussions of climate change.

This is in addition to the major changes taking place in the international trade landscape, which are adding tension to the global economy. This, in turn, impacts the economies of all countries, particularly developing countries, undermining their efforts to drive growth and achieve desired development.

In 2015, the international community agreed on the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), as a comprehensive framework for the advancement of our peoples and the provision of a better life and future for them. However, the dangerous widening of the development and financing gap over the past years could make achieving these goals by 2030 unattainable unless effective steps are taken to address it.

Accordingly, we look forward to the ambitious and tangible outcomes of the Fourth International Conference on Financing for Development, reflecting our collective will to take urgent action to achieve the Sustainable Development Goals.

Within this framework, Egypt looks forward to achieving progress in the following issues during the conference:

First:

Developing a roadmap to enhance developing countries’ access to concessional and low-cost financing. This necessitates addressing existing structural imbalances in the global financial system and fostering international cooperation with development partners.

In this context, we look forward to reaching consensus on effective measures to further advance the reform of the global financial architecture and international financial institutions. This is in addition to strengthening existing financing mechanisms; establishing innovative new mechanisms, such as debt swaps; developing integrated financing frameworks to stimulate private sector investment; and reinforce the interconnection between the implementation of the Addis Ababa Action Agenda on Financing for Development and the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goals.

Second:

We underscore the critical need to elevate ambition for reforming the global debt architecture and to formulate concrete and actionable steps to contain the escalating challenge of sovereign debt in developing countries. Such measures should include the development of mechanisms for sustainable debt management in both low-income and middle-income countries, which collectively account for approximately two-thirds of the world’s impoverished population.

Egypt emphasizes that failure to achieve tangible outcomes in this regard could cause a new global debt crisis, severely destabilizing our economies and exacerbating the already widening development gap.

Third:

We emphasize the vital importance of providing necessary technical support and building the institutional and human capacities of developing nations. This includes technology transfer and the promotion of modern technological and digital tools, including Artificial Intelligence. Such efforts are vital to strengthen these countries’ endeavors to achieve sustainable development and leverage their national resources.
